Pesto Salmon Recipe

If you love quick, flavor-packed dinners that feel special but require almost no effort, you’ll adore this Pesto Salmon. This recipe transforms fresh salmon fillets into a colorful main dish with a blanket of herby, garlicky pesto and a golden, cheesy crust. It’s vibrant, aromatic, and ready in just 20 minutes—perfect for busy nights or an impressive weekend meal.

Why You’ll Love This Recipe

  • Dinner in 20 Minutes: Pesto Salmon goes from fridge to table in under half an hour—ideal for busy weeknights or last-minute dinner guests.
  • Incredible Flavor, Zero Fuss: Store-bought or homemade pesto infuses the salmon with bold, Italian-inspired flavor, while a quick breadcrumb-Parmesan topping adds irresistible crunch.
  • Minimal Ingredients, Big Result: With just five simple ingredients, you’ll get a meal that tastes gourmet with barely any prep—and you’ll only dirty one pan!
  • Eye-Catching Presentation: The vibrant green pesto and golden Parmesan crust make this dish as beautiful as it is delicious—perfect for impressing family or friends.
Pesto Salmon Recipe - Recipe Image

Ingredients You’ll Need

One of my favorite things about this Pesto Salmon is the way just a handful of kitchen staples come together to deliver huge flavor and gorgeous color. Let’s break down what you’ll need and why each ingredient matters to the final dish.

  • Salmon Fillets (24 ounces, 4 fillets): Choose fresh, center-cut fillets for the best texture; both skin-on and skinless work perfectly.
  • Pesto (6-7 tablespoons): Vibrant basil pesto brings irresistible herby, garlicky, and nutty notes—use homemade or your favorite good-quality store-bought brand.
  • Fresh Breadcrumbs (⅓ cup): Fresh (not dry) breadcrumbs create a light, delicate topping that crisps up beautifully in the oven.
  • Parmesan Cheese (⅓ cup, freshly grated): Real Parmesan, grated with a microplane, melts and browns into a salty, savory crust.
  • Vegetable Spray: A quick spritz on the foil ensures the fillets won’t stick and makes cleanup a breeze.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

This Pesto Salmon recipe is as flexible as it is delicious, and you can easily swap ingredients or tailor it to your needs. Here are some fun ways to put your own spin on it and keep it fresh every time you make it!

  • Try Different Pestos: Switch things up with sun-dried tomato pesto, arugula pesto, or even a dairy-free pesto if you prefer.
  • Use Another Fish: Not a salmon fan? This recipe works beautifully with trout or cod—just adjust cooking time as needed for thickness.
  • Gluten-Free Option: Use gluten-free breadcrumbs or crushed rice crackers for a celiac-friendly meal with all the crunch.
  • Topping Boosters: Add chopped toasted nuts (like pine nuts or almonds) to the breadcrumb mixture for extra texture and flavor.

How to Make Pesto Salmon

Step 1: Prep the Oven and Baking Sheet

Start by preheating your oven to 400°F (200°C). Line a rimmed baking sheet with foil and give it a quick spray of vegetable oil so your salmon is easy to lift off later with zero sticking. This also keeps cleanup simple, letting you spend more time enjoying dinner and less time scrubbing pans.

Step 2: Arrange and Top the Salmon

Lay the salmon fillets evenly on the baking sheet with a little breathing room between each piece—this helps them bake uniformly and lets the topping crisp up. Spoon about 1½ tablespoons of basil pesto onto each fillet and gently spread it across the surface with the back of a spoon or small spatula, making sure every bite gets a gorgeous coating of pesto.

Step 3: Mix and Apply the Crust

In a small bowl, stir together the fresh breadcrumbs and grated Parmesan. Sprinkle this mixture generously over your pesto-topped fillets, lightly pressing it so it adheres. This step is where your Pesto Salmon gets its signature golden, crispy finish—don’t skimp!

Step 4: Bake and Serve

Bake in the center of your preheated oven for 12 minutes for medium (the salmon stays moist and tender), or up to 15 minutes if you prefer it cooked through. The cheese will bubble, the breadcrumbs will brown, and your kitchen will smell absolutely heavenly! Serve immediately while the top is crisp and the salmon is flaky.

Pro Tips for Making Pesto Salmon

  • Choose the Freshest Salmon: For the most tender and flavorful result, look for salmon fillets that are moist, brightly colored, and free of strong odors—wild or sustainably farmed both work well.
  • Don’t Skip the Fresh Breadcrumbs: Using fresh (not dried) breadcrumbs makes the crust extra crisp and prevents it from drying out—simply blitz day-old bread in a food processor in seconds.
  • Even Topping Equals Even Baking: Make sure the pesto and breadcrumb-Parmesan topping are spread in a thin, even layer to guarantee every fillet bakes at the same rate and gets perfectly golden.
  • Watch for Doneness: Salmon is best when it flakes easily but still looks moist—start checking at 12 minutes and don’t overbake for juiciest results.

How to Serve Pesto Salmon

Pesto Salmon Recipe - Recipe Image

Garnishes

A simple shower of extra grated Parmesan, a fresh squeeze of lemon, or some finely chopped basil sprinkled on top will make your Pesto Salmon pop with color and freshness. Even a crack of black pepper or a light drizzle of good olive oil can elevate the dish just before serving.

Side Dishes

This salmon pairs beautifully with so many sides! Try a crisp green salad, simple roasted vegetables, lemon herbed rice, or buttery new potatoes. It’s equally at home next to a bowl of pasta tossed with more pesto if you want to double down on that Italian vibe.

Creative Ways to Present

For an impressive touch, serve your Pesto Salmon fillets atop a swirl of creamy polenta or nestle them over a pile of garlicky sautéed greens. For a dinner party, slice fillets into smaller portions and arrange on a large platter, scattered with lemon wedges and fresh herbs—stunning and effortlessly elegant!

Make Ahead and Storage

Storing Leftovers

Cool leftover Pesto Salmon to room temperature, then transfer to an airtight container. It will keep fresh in the refrigerator for up to 2 days. The topping will soften as it sits, but the flavors meld even more and make a great cold salmon lunch!

Freezing

If you’d like to freeze this dish, cool the salmon completely and wrap each piece tightly in plastic wrap followed by foil. Freeze for up to 2 months. Be aware that while the salmon itself holds up well, the topping will lose some of its crunch after thawing, but it’s still delicious!

Reheating

To reheat Pesto Salmon, place it on a foil-lined baking sheet and warm in a 325°F oven for 8-10 minutes, just until heated through. This gentle heat helps the topping re-crisp a bit without drying out the fish. Avoid the microwave if possible, as it can make salmon rubbery.

FAQs

  1. Can I use frozen salmon fillets for this recipe?

    Absolutely! For best results, thaw your salmon fillets overnight in the refrigerator and pat them dry before proceeding. This ensures the pesto and breadcrumb topping stick well and bake up crisp.

  2. What type of pesto works best for Pesto Salmon?

    Classic basil pesto is the go-to, but feel free to experiment with other types like arugula pesto, spinach pesto, or even sun-dried tomato pesto. Just make sure your pesto has good flavor and a thick, spoonable consistency.

  3. Can I make Pesto Salmon ahead of time?

    You can prep the salmon with its pesto and topping up to a few hours ahead—just cover and refrigerate until ready to bake. For best texture, bake fresh before serving so the crust stays crisp.

  4. Is this recipe suitable for kids or picky eaters?

    Definitely! Many kids love the mild, buttery flavor of salmon, and the herby pesto and crunchy topping are crowd-pleasers. If you’re concerned about strong pesto flavors, use a lighter hand or choose a milder pesto variety.

Final Thoughts

I hope you give this Pesto Salmon a try the next time you need a dinner that feels both effortless and special. There’s something magical about the way the fragrant green pesto, crispy cheese crust, and tender salmon come together. Dive in, make it your own, and enjoy every flavorful bite with someone you love!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Pesto Salmon Recipe

Pesto Salmon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.8 from 149 reviews
  • Author: Lisa
  • Prep Time: 5 minutes
  • Cook Time: 15 minutes
  • Total Time: 20 minutes
  • Yield: 4 servings 1x
  • Category: Main Course
  • Method: Baking
  • Cuisine: Italian
  • Diet: Gluten Free

Description

This Pesto Salmon recipe combines the richness of salmon with the vibrant flavors of basil pesto, creating a delicious and easy-to-make dish that is perfect for any day of the week.


Ingredients

Units Scale

Salmon:

  • 24 ounces salmon fillets (4 6-ounce fillets)

Pesto:

  • 67 tablespoons pesto

Breadcrumb Topping:

  • 1/3 cup fresh breadcrumbs
  • 1/3 cup freshly grated parmesan cheese (grated with a microplane grater if possible)

Instructions

  1. Preheat the oven: Preheat the oven to 400°F. Line a rimmed baking sheet with foil and spray with vegetable spray.
  2. Prepare the salmon: Place the salmon fillets on the baking sheet. Spread 1½ tablespoons of pesto on each fillet.
  3. Make the breadcrumb topping: Combine breadcrumbs and parmesan in a bowl. Sprinkle the mixture over the salmon fillets.
  4. Cook the salmon: Bake for 12-15 minutes until the salmon is cooked to your desired doneness.


Nutrition

  • Serving Size: 1 fillet
  • Calories: 390
  • Sugar: 1g
  • Sodium: 460mg
  • Fat: 24g
  • Saturated Fat: 6g
  • Unsaturated Fat: 14g
  • Trans Fat: 0g
  • Carbohydrates: 6g
  • Fiber: 1g
  • Protein: 37g
  • Cholesterol: 95m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star